Mountain West Honors Top Performers with Weekly Awards

UNLV's Nin Burns II, Grand Canyon's Garrett Ahern and Tanner Johns Receive Player, Pitcher, and Freshman Accolades

The Mountain West Conference revealed its latest batch of weekly baseball honors, spotlighting three standout athletes whose performances helped shape recent series outcomes across the league.

Player of the Week: Nin Burns II

Senior outfielder Nin Burns II of UNLV powered the Rebels to a decisive series victory over San Diego State, batting .583 with seven hits that included a double and two home runs. His on‑base percentage of .583 and slugging percentage of 1.167 underscored a dominant offensive week.

Pitcher of the Week: Garrett Ahern

Junior pitcher Garrett Ahern from Grand Canyon delivered a six‑inning scoreless relief outing that earned him the win against Nevada on Saturday. He limited the opposition to four hits and a single walk while striking out six batters, showcasing both control and dominance on the mound.

Freshman of the Week: Tanner Johns

Freshman outfielder Tanner Johns contributed heavily to Grand Canyon's series triumph over Nevada, posting a .462 batting average with six hits, six RBIs and three runs scored. His on‑base percentage of .533 and slugging percentage of .769 highlighted a promising start to his collegiate career.

These recognitions reflect the competitive intensity of the Mountain West and set the stage for upcoming conference matchups, as each program looks to build momentum heading into the latter part of the season.
